Theanine is a special chemical found mostly in tea leaves and some mushrooms. It's a type of building block called an amino acid. Theanine is known for its cool effects on your body and mind. It can help you feel more relaxed and focused.

This amazing chemical helps to lower stress and makes you feel calmer. It's also an antioxidant, which means it helps protect your body's cells from damage. Think of antioxidants as tiny superheroes fighting off bad stuff in your body! Theanine also gives a boost to your immune system, which is your body's natural shield against sickness and diseases.

What is Theanine?

Theanine is an amino acid, but it's not one of the common ones your body uses to build proteins. Instead, it has unique jobs, especially in your brain. It was first found in green tea leaves in Japan in 1949. Since then, scientists have learned a lot about how it works.

Where Does Theanine Come From?

The main source of theanine is the tea plant, known as Camellia sinensis. This is the plant that gives us all kinds of tea, like green tea, black tea, and oolong tea. The amount of theanine can be different depending on how the tea is grown and processed. For example, shaded teas, like matcha, often have more theanine. You can also find smaller amounts of theanine in certain types of mushrooms, such as the bay bolete.

How Theanine Helps Your Body

Theanine has several cool benefits that make it interesting for your health. It works in different ways to support your well-being.

Feeling Calm and Focused

One of the most well-known effects of theanine is its ability to help you relax without making you feel sleepy. It can help your brain produce more alpha waves. These waves are linked to a state of relaxed alertness, like when you're meditating or daydreaming. This means theanine can help you focus better on tasks, like homework or a game, while also feeling less stressed.

Fighting Stress

Life can sometimes be stressful, even for kids! Theanine can help your body manage stress. It does this by affecting certain chemicals in your brain that are involved in mood and stress responses. By helping to balance these chemicals, theanine can make you feel calmer and less overwhelmed when things get tough.

Boosting Your Immune System

Your immune system is super important because it protects you from germs and helps you stay healthy. Theanine has been shown to support the immune system. This means it can help your body's defenses work better, making you more ready to fight off colds and other illnesses.

Antioxidant Power

As an antioxidant, theanine helps protect your cells from damage caused by things called "free radicals." These free radicals are like tiny troublemakers that can harm your cells over time. Antioxidants, like theanine, act like bodyguards, protecting your cells and keeping them healthy. This can help your body stay strong and work well as you grow.
